Every MediaTek (MTK) processor requires a specific text file to manage its internal memory. For devices running the MT8127 processor (commonly used in tablets like the Dragon Touch M7 or Allview Viva Q7 Satellite), the MT8127_Android_scatter.txt acts as an index. Connect your powered-off tablet to the PC using the USB cable. The flashing process should start automatically. You'll see a red progress bar, followed by purple, then yellow. The process completes with a green checkmark indicating "Download OK".

Some firmware packages include checksum verification lines at the end of the scatter file. These lines can cause flashing errors. If you encounter problems, open the MT8127_Android_scatter.txt file in a text editor and delete the last two lines (typically comments containing checksum information, like # [huaqin] # checkSum = 0x0f5e ) before loading it into SP Flash Tool.
